Info Density Power-words vs. Substance ratio.
7 Impact Weight: 30 / 100
23% BS

The information density is exceptionally high for this industry. While some headings use edgy power words like Principles of Unshittification or The Way Is Open, the body text immediately grounds these in technical reality, citing specific database versions (MySQL 9.7) and protocols (LDAP, ACLs). The Downloads page provides actual substance with functional software distributions and Kubernetes Operators rather than marketing brochures.

Semantic Coherence Homepage promise vs. Sub-page reality.
0 Impact Weight: 20 / 100
0% BS

There is zero detectable semantic drift between the homepage promises and sub-page deliverables. The H1 claim of being Forever free from lock-in is explicitly supported by the Valkey/Redis page, which explains the specific license transition (BSD-3-Clause) and the software-led support model that facilitates migration from proprietary forks.

Trust & Proof Verifiable evidence vs. Trust Theatre.
2 Impact Weight: 20 / 100
10% BS

Trust theatre is minimal because the site uses high-authority named testimonials. Review counts (9-10) are modest and believable, supported by specific names and titles from global entities like Ryanair and BBVA. However, a small penalty is applied as these reviews are not direct-linked to external platforms like G2 or Gartner Peer Insights within the provided data.

Proof density is high. Across 4 pages, we find 8+ specific technical proof points, including named clients (Trend Micro, Ryanair), specific software versions (PostgreSQL 3.0.0), and clear architectural frameworks (three-node cluster). The ratio of assertions to verifiable evidence is approximately 1:4.

Commodity Fingerprint Detection of industry clichés/templates.
4 Impact Weight: 15 / 100
27% BS

The site largely avoids the standard MSP template of IT solutions simplified or focus on your business, we handle the tech. Instead, it adopts a combative, expert-led stance against corporate BS. The industry cliché density is low, though it does use standard terms like 24x7x365 support and enterprise-grade.

Identity & Authority Expert verifiability & Schema depth.
3 Impact Weight: 15 / 100
20% BS

The site establishes strong authority by naming specific contributors and engineers like Slava Sarzhan and Evgeniy Patlan in their technical resources. A minor gap exists in the provided structured data, which uses basic WebPage and WebSite types but lacks detailed Organization or Person schema to connect these experts to their digital footprints (sameAs).

Performance claims are backed by verifiable methodology. For instance, the multi-threaded I/O model for Valkey is presented alongside a Savings and Performance Calculator, moving the claim from marketing fluff to an interactive technical proof point.
